Plaintiffs' Summary of Alleged Murder-Related Profits (Plaintiffs' Exhibit No. 2414)

Plaintiffs' Exhibit No. 2414 was a multi-page summary characterizing $2,818,136 in receipts as profits from murder-related activities, including the book “I Want to Tell You” ($991,743), a video ($303,500), Star tabloid photographs ($433,693), interviews ($75,300), and autographs, memorabilia, and other items ($1,013,900). The summary was described as drawn from defense-provided financial records and check copies, and Taft confirmed its accuracy when it was displayed during his redirect examination.
